Joseph Read (Service No 2417) was born in Maitland, N.S.W. around 1879.

At enlistment Joseph was single, 37 years of age, lived in Wollongong, N.S.W. and worked as a wharf labourer.  Joseph had served 8 years in the Militia.  He listed his sister, Mary Read, Wollongong Public School, as his next of kin.

Joseph embarked from Melbourne on HMAT A 68 Anchises with 4th Rreinforcements, 31st Battalion, on 14th March 1916.

The troops arrived in Egypt on 15th April 1916 and Joesph was transferred to the 1st Pioneer Battalion on 8th May 1916.  He arrived in France on 29th May 1916 and saw service on the Western Front.

On 4th March 1918 he was admitted to hospital suffering from bronchitis.

He was returned to Australia in April 1918 with cronic bronchitis and discharged medically unfit on 9th October 1918.

Joseph died in 1947 and is buried in Rookwood Cemetery, Sydney.
